When we think of dangerous pests, flies might not be the first thing that comes to mind. But these little pests can cause a big problem, especially when they invade your home.

Flies are more than just a nuisance; they can be dangerous to your health. These insects can spread harmful bacteria like salmonella and E. coli and contaminate food with their feces. If you have a fly problem, removing it is essential to the health and safety of your home and family.

Factors That Can Cause A Fly Infestation In Your Omaha Home

Bottle fly on food

While a few flies here and there are usually nothing to worry about, a sudden influx of them can signify a serious infestation. Here are some of the most common causes of fly infestations in Omaha homes and what you can do to prevent them:

  • Food attractants: Food attracts flies, so if you're leaving dirty dishes on the counter or not cleaning up spills, you're essentially inviting them into your home.
  • Pet waste: If you have pets, it's important to clean up their waste immediately so that flies don't have a chance to lay their eggs in it. This action will help you get rid of flies outdoors and prevent them from coming in.
  • Trash not sealed properly: If the garbage is left unattended for too long, flies will lay their eggs in it, and you'll soon have a full-blown infestation on your hands. To avoid this, make sure to seal your trash cans tightly and take the garbage out regularly.
  • Standing water: If you have any leaks or standing water on your property, address these issues quickly, as they could lead to an infestation.

Frequently Asked Questions About Fly Control

A few different types of flies are common in Omaha, including house flies, fruit flies, and gnats. Because the method of extermination differs for each type of fly, it's important to know which type you're dealing with, so you can treat the problem accordingly.
